- Annuity: The renewal fee is paid every 5 years. If the annual fee is overdue, the payment can be postponed within 6 months after the due date at the latest, but an additional penalty of 12.00 euros is required.

20 years, and the protection of pesticide or pharmaceutical patents can be extended to 25 years.
Reinstatement of priority on grounds of "due care" accepted.
